FILE
Example A-19 uses the FILE option to direct noft to examine the loadfile,
EXAMPLE1.
Example A-19. FILE Option (Loadfile)
noft> FILE EXAMPLE1
Object File : \DLLQA.$D0117.CRGMAN.example1
File Format : ELF
Scope : (none)
Case : Sensitive
